To integrate many resources and build a collaborative partner ecosystem in South China, AsiaInfo Technologies recently held its "Trust · Partners - Intelligence for Future" Ecosystem Partners Summit in Guangzhou. The summit drew hundreds of representatives from partner institutions across Guangdong, Guangxi, Hainan and other regions. AsiaInfo Technologies launched a dedicated partnership program for South China and entered into strategic authorization agreements with 16 regionally representative enterprises. Leaders including Xu Wenjin (Director of the Administrative Committee of Tianhe Technology Park, Guangzhou High-Tech Industrial Development Zone) and Leng Bingshuang (Deputy Secretary of the Party Committee and Secretary of the Committee for Discipline Inspection) attended the summit.

At the summit's capabilities presentation, the experts from AsiaInfo Technologies, China Mobile, AsiaInfo Security and iResearch systematically presented an end-to-end closed-loop service system covering "top-level design, product R & D, implementation and delivery, and security safeguarding".
Figure: Guests deliver speeches
Wang Tao (General Manager of the Data Product Center at AsiaInfo Technologies) presented three product systems including "Digital Intelligence", "Cloud Network" and "IT" as well as many industry-specific cases based on industry-specific large models, big data, private 5G network and digital twin.
Zheng Wenwen (Technical Expert at China Mobile Information Center) presented the Panji Stack product system, and highlighted the Panwei Database self-developed by China Mobile and characterized by "high compatibility, reliability, performance and security".
Huang Xiaobo (Channel Director for Southern Region at AsiaInfo Security) presented the network security service framework integrating "Product + Platform + Service" based on the practice of verticals.
Zhong Lisha (Senior Director of the Marketing Department at iResearch) expounded how AsiaInfo Technologies and iResearch can help enterprises explore new overseas market and expand domestic market when facing tariff challenges. Relying on 23 years of experience, iResearch empowers enterprises to " Explore market, understand customer needs and optimize marketing" through industry research, consultation and operating practice.
